Couple Dashes Out Jared Jewelers With Rolex Watch On Wrist

Christmas comes early for a pair of thieves who stole a Rolex watch Friday from Jared Galleria of Jewelry.

The Utica police are looking for a couple that tried on a Rolex watch valued at $7,442 at on Hall Road Friday and dashed out.

Police said the man and woman entered the store around 11:30 a.m. and asked an employee to try on a specific Rolex watch.  The employee told police the man then asked to try on another Rolex watch.

After the employee placed the watch on the man's arm, he yelled, "go" to the woman and ran out the door to the parking lot, according to a police report.

The woman followed behind after a short delay, police said. 

Police and K-9 units combed the parking lot for evidence, but police dogs lost the couple's scent in the parking lot.

Witnesses described the man as black, 20-30 years old, with a thin build and 6 feet 3 inches. He was wearing a tan sweat suit. The woman is described as black and wearing a navy pea coat and black pants.

Anyone with information is asked to call the Utica Police Department at 586-731-2345.
